The brief

This is not a tender exercise by the Education Authority.

The EA is currently preparing to initiate the a procurement process for the supply and delivery of Musical Instruments and associated equipment and supplies to cover all EA schools and Music Service Centres.

The purpose of this market consultation exercise is to gain an understanding of the latest developments and innovations in the provision Musical Instruments and associated equipment and to assist the Education Authority (EA) in ensuring that the most efficient and effective methods for the supply and delivery of such items are undertaken and included in its forthcoming procurement exercise.

Any information gathered through this market consultation exercise will inform internal business planning and any possible subsequent procurement process and will NOT be appraised in any future procurement exercise.

Please note that participation or non-participation in this preliminary market consultation exercise shall not prevent any supplier participating in any potential procurement process, nor is it intended that any information supplied shall place any supplier at an advantage or disadvantage in any forthcoming procurement process.

For the avoidance of doubt, this is the scoping phase of the project and is not part of a formal procurement process.

EA would like to invite participation in the market consultation exercise, by interested suppliers completing a questionnaire.

This questionnaire will be used to assist in gaining a better understanding of the feasibility of the requirements, the most appropriate procurement and operational approach, the capacity of the market to deliver the requirements and an opportunity for the market to highlight any possible risks or issues that may not have previously been considered.

Any submission received in response to this exercise will not constitute any contractual agreement between the respondent and the EA.

All completed questionnaires must be returned via the Secure Messaging function on eTendersNI no later than 3pm on Friday 6th August 2021
